Corporate Immigration Law Career Developer

Job Overview:

A comprehensive training program for recent law graduates to develop a career in corporate immigration law.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Proactively manage client workflows under supervision and maintain direct client contact, ensuring seamless communication and timely resolution of matters.
  • Prepare and file visa applications that meet legal requirements with the support of experienced lawyers, adhering to regulatory guidelines and industry best practices.
  • Draft legal documents, client correspondence, and conduct day-to-day liaison with clients, providing exceptional service and maintaining a professional demeanor.
  • Assist in client interviews and complete legal research in a fast-paced environment, leveraging expertise and resources to drive results.

Required Skills and Qualifications:

  • Recent law graduate or soon-to-be admitted lawyer with excellent written and oral communication skills, strong analytical and problem-solving abilities, and a keen eye for detail.
  • Focused on delivering exceptional client service with attention to organizational and time-management skills, ability to work independently, and perform in a fast-paced environment.
  • Proficient in various systems and technology, with an effective team player approach and flexible attitude to adapt to changing circumstances.

Benefits:

  • Hybrid work arrangements – working from home 2 days a week, promoting work-life balance and flexibility.
  • Comprehensive in-house training and CPD programs, supporting ongoing professional development and growth.
  • Birthday leave and paid parental leave – 13 to 18 weeks dependent on tenure, recognizing the importance of personal well-being and family responsibilities.
  • Fitness allowance – $500 per year to claim and premium Headspace membership, fostering physical and mental wellness.
  • Wellness days and access to employee assistance programs, prioritizing employee health and wellbeing.
